    Lian Li PC-V351B + TRUE

    Will a TRUE 120 black fit?

    Nope That is not possible unless you are going to mount the PSU somewhere else.

    I've got that case and the largest heatsink I can fit is a Scythe Ninja Mini. The nuts on the top hit when removing or inserting the mobo tray, but it fits. The case is retired now because it didn't have adequate cooling for me, but it's still nice...just wish I could get rid of it

    someone on here made a custom rear bracket that shifted the PSU over the PCI slots, this allowed a tall tower heatsink to be used

    you lose the drive bays or whatever it is there though
